Output 98e43cbb5c0f64d53ba44aef232dba5221f89c0e23054ae5856e63c34fe7f4a6:0

value
25082
script pubkey
OP_0 OP_PUSHBYTES_20 89d20bb31526f44c4d98ca7099857d9bce71c16e
address
bc1q38fqhvc4ym6ycnvcefcfnptan088rstwhr5n82
transaction
98e43cbb5c0f64d53ba44aef232dba5221f89c0e23054ae5856e63c34fe7f4a6